Call for volunteers – VALA Art Center Steward

VALA, Venues for Artists in the Local Area, Eastside, is a 501c3, non-profit arts organization committed to connecting artists to artists, artists to the community, and the community to art. We are thrilled to be opening the new VALA Art Center, located in the Redmond Town Center, where we will feature artist residencies, installations by local artists, public community events, and educational programs for all ages. We hope the VALA Art Center will become a hotspot for artists in the community to meet, share and create.

As a volunteer, you will have the opportunity use your skills, connect with artists and the public while helping operate this very special community public art venue in Redmond. You don’t have to be an artist to volunteer with VALA. We are looking for volunteers who are passionate about art, enjoy interacting with the public and feel committed to raising awareness about art in our community.

 Responsibilities include:

 - Opening and/or closing the center

- Greeting guests as they arrive

- Distributing information about VALA and our programming

- Familiarizing yourself with the artwork on display and directing visitors to artist contact information

- Other opportunities may become available
